María Gutiérrez-Cueto y Blanchard was a Spanish painter. She was known for developing a unique style of Cubism. == Biography == Blanchard was born on 6 March 1881 in Santander, Spain. She was the daughter of journalist Enrique Gutiérrez Cueto and Concepción Blanchard Santisteban. She was the cousin of Mexican artist Germán Cueto and Spanish writer and socialist Matilde de la Torre.
